单变量分析绘图及回归分析绘图
综述
学生党整理一些关于数据分析的知识:整理了单变量分析绘图及回归分析绘图的部分代码。主要包括了数据直方图、数据分布状态、指定均值协方差生成数据、散点图绘制、多特征分析;绘制回归图、离散型数据分析及直方图散点图结合的回归图绘制。
代码模块
调用库
import seaborn as sns
import pandas as pd
import numpy as np
import matplotlib.pyplot as plt
from scipy import stats, integrate
单变量分析绘图
数据直方图
通过数据直方图可以观测变量的分布状况
sns.set(color_codes=True)
np.random.seed(sum(map(ord,"distributions")))
x = np.random.normal(size=100)
sns.distplot(x,kde=False)
plt.show()
指定bins = 20
sns.distplot(x,bins=20,kde=False)
plt.show()
数据分布状态
数据柱状图和曲线图表示数据分布状态
x = np.random.normal(6,size=200)
sns.distplot(x,kde=